"Orbit: Nick Jonas" by Michael Frizell explores the life and career of the multi-talented artist Nick Jonas. The book delves into Jonas's rise to fame as a member of the Jonas Brothers, his ventures into solo music, acting, and his impact on pop culture. It highlights personal stories, challenges, and triumphs, providing insights into his family life and relationships. The narrative also examines his musical evolution and the influence he carries as a role model for fans.
